| 背景信息 | Cytokine induced apoptosis inhibitor 1 (CIAPIN1) is a growth factor-dependent inhibitor of apoptosis that operates independently of the BCL2 and caspase families. It serves as a critical component of the cytosolic iron-sulfur (Fe-S) protein assembly machinery, facilitating electron transfer processes essential for enzymes involved in metabolism, DNA maintenance, and iron homeostasis. CIAPIN1 localizes to the cytoplasm, nucleus, and nucleolus, participating in diverse regulatory pathways. Clinically, CIAPIN1 is associated with Wolfram Syndrome 2 and gastric cancer, where it contributes to multidrug resistance by upregulating resistance genes and modulating cell proliferation via cyclin D1. In other cancer models, such as breast and lung cancer, it may inhibit migration and invasion by modulating ERK1/2 signaling and epithelial-mesenchymal transition. |
